Gemma Owen’s Love Island ex Luca Bish is reportedly heading back to the dating show for its All Stars series.The move could be a nightmare for Gemma, the daughter of ex-England football star Michael, with fears her former beau will spill details of their break-up.

Fishmonger Luca, 25, and Gemma, 21, fell in love during the ITV2 show’s summer series in 2022, and came runners up to Ekin-Su Culculoglu and Davide Sanclimenti, but split three months later.

Now he is back for the All Stars spin-off series in Cape Town, South Africa, which Maya Jama will host in January. A TV source told the Sun: “This is the last thing Gemma wants because in the last year she’s tried to keep her personal life private. "Their break-up was shrouded in secrecy and neither has discussed it, but it did not end well.

He hinted he was blindsided by the break-up when she posted it online and this is his time to spill the beans.” OK! has reached out to representatives for Gemma, Luca and ITV for comment.
